Abstract

The application discloses a near field communication interaction method, a user terminal, a card swiping terminal, a medium and a product, and belongs to the technical field of near field communication. The method comprises the following steps: acquiring a scene message broadcasted by a card swiping terminal; analyzing the scene information to obtain a target scene identifier of the scene where the card swiping terminal is located; under the condition that the NFC radio frequency signal is detected, an NFC management application is called up, and a target NFC analog card matched with the target scene identification is selected from a plurality of NFC analog cards through the NFC management application; determining the current NFC communication object of the user terminal as a target NFC analog card; and performing near field communication interaction with the card swiping terminal through the target NFC analog card. According to the NFC simulation card selection method and device, the problem that the accuracy of selecting the NFC simulation card through the geographic position is low and the NFC simulation card cannot be accurately matched with the correct NFC simulation card can be solved.

Background
Near field communication technology (Near Field Communication, NFC) is an emerging technology, and as it continues to spread, more and more electronic devices can support near field communication functions, and electronic devices using NFC technology can exchange data in a situation where they are close to each other.
At present, an electronic device supporting a near field communication function generally installs a plurality of NFC analog cards, such as a bank card, an access control card, a traffic card, and the like, and when a card is swiped, the device uses a default NFC analog card to interact, and if other NFC analog cards are to be used, a user is usually required to manually select the card on a display interface of the electronic device, which takes a long time and affects the card swiping efficiency and experience.
Therefore, in order to improve the card swiping efficiency, a card swiping scheme for selecting an NFC analog card based on a geographic position is provided in the related art, however, the accuracy of selecting the NFC analog card through the geographic position is not high, for example, the geographic position to which the traffic card is applicable is not fixed and is relatively wide, and in this scenario, the situation of matching to the wrong NFC analog card easily occurs, so that the NFC analog card cannot be accurately matched.

Fig. 1 is a schematic architecture diagram of an example of an application scenario of a near field communication interaction method according to an embodiment of the present application.
As shown in fig. 1, the architecture system of the near field communication interaction method may include a user terminal 11 and a card swiping terminal 12.
The user terminal 11 is a terminal device with an NFC analog card, and may specifically include a mobile phone, a tablet computer, an intelligent wearable device, etc., and the specific type of the user terminal 11 is not limited herein. The user terminal 11 supports a card mode, which is to simulate the electronic device with NFC function into a contactless radio frequency card conforming to the NFC related standard, where the contactless radio frequency card is an NFC analog card, and the user terminal 11 can perform NFC communication interaction and data interaction with the swipe card terminal 12 by using the NFC analog card. The user terminal 11 may be provided with an NFC management application for managing an NFC emulated card, where the NFC emulated card may be displayed on an application interface of the NFC management application in the form of an electronic card, and when a user needs to use a certain NFC emulated card, the user may directly open the NFC emulated card in the NFC management application, and approach the user terminal 11 to the card swiping terminal 12 to swipe the card or swipe the card. For example, the user terminal 11 is brought close to the card reader (i.e., the card reader terminal 12) on the gate to realize the card reading gate. The user terminal 11 may include an NFC control chip, on which the functions of an inductive card reader, an inductive card and peer-to-peer communication may be integrated, so that applications such as mobile payment, electronic ticketing, entrance guard, mobile identity recognition, anti-counterfeiting, etc. may be implemented through the user terminal 11.
The card swiping terminal 12 is a card swiping device, i.e., a card reader, for reading NFC tags. The card swiping terminal 12 can be used as a card swiping device to perform NFC communication interaction with the user terminal 11, and read an NFC analog card in the user terminal 11.

Involves step 210 of obtaining a scene message broadcast by the swipe terminal.
In step 210, the card swiping terminal may broadcast the scene message through a preset broadcasting method, which may include, but is not limited to: bluetooth, wireless communication technology WIFI, wireless carrier communication technology (UWB), radio frequency identification (Radio Frequency Identification, RFID) technology; correspondingly, the user terminal can acquire the scene message in the same information acquisition mode as the preset broadcasting mode.
Step 220 is involved, the scene message is parsed, and the target scene identifier of the scene where the card swiping terminal is located is obtained.
In step 220, the scene message may carry a scene identifier of the scene in which the card swiping terminal is located, that is, a target scene identifier, and the scene message broadcast by the card swiping terminal is different based on the difference of the scenes in which the card swiping terminal is located.
For an access card swiping terminal, in a scene message broadcast by an access card swiping terminal in a 'company' scene, the carried target scene is identified as a 'company-access', and in a scene message broadcast by an access card swiping terminal in a 'home' scene, the carried target scene is identified as a 'home-access'.
In some embodiments of the present application, the scene identifier may be stored in a payload of the scene message, so that the user terminal may obtain the target scene identifier carried in the scene message by parsing the payload of the scene message.
In some embodiments of the application, the scene identification may be determined using standard codes or naming rules.
Step 230 is involved, in the case of detecting the NFC radio frequency signal, invoking the NFC management application, and selecting, by the NFC management application, a target NFC emulated card from the plurality of NFC emulated cards that matches the target scene identifier.
In step 230, when the user terminal approaches the card swiping terminal, the card swiping operation is started, and at this time, the user terminal may sense an NFC radio frequency signal emitted by the card swiping terminal, where the NFC radio frequency signal is used to read an NFC analog card in the user terminal. Therefore, when the NFC radio frequency signal is detected, the user terminal starts an NFC management application, where the NFC management application is configured to manage NFC analog cards, where the NFC management application includes a plurality of NFC analog cards, where the plurality of NFC analog cards may be integrated on the NFC management application, where the NFC management application may be, for example, a wallet application, and where the NFC management application may be called by the NFC controller, and after being called, the NFC management application may select, from the plurality of NFC analog cards, a target NFC analog card matching the target scene identifier for performing NFC communication interaction with the card swiping terminal.

In some embodiments of the present application, in order to ensure the scene suitability of the selected target NFC emulated card and the card swiping terminal, fig. 3 is a flowchart of another embodiment of the near field communication interaction method provided in the first aspect of the present application, and step 210 may be preceded by steps 310 to 330 shown in fig. 3.
Step 310, acquiring scene types associated with a plurality of NFC analog cards;
step 320, dividing the NFC emulated cards associated with the same scene type into the same scene group to obtain a plurality of scene groups;
step 330, setting corresponding packet identifications for a plurality of scene packets based on scene types associated with the NFC emulated card in the scene packets.
For example, the plurality of NFC emulated cards may include card a, card B, card C, and card D, wherein the scene types associated with card a and card B are each a "consumption-bank card", the scene type associated with card C is a "traffic-bus card", and the scene type associated with card D is a "home-entrance guard" so that card a, card B, card C, and card D are respectively divided into three groups.
In the embodiment of the application, by dividing the NFC analog cards associated with the same scene type into the same scene group in advance, one scene group can be allocated to each scene. In this way, under different scenes, by selecting the target NFC analog card from the scene group adapted to the target NFC analog card, the adaptation of the selected target NFC analog card and the scene where the card swiping terminal is located can be ensured, and therefore the correctness of the NFC analog card read by the card swiping terminal is ensured.
In other embodiments of the present application, the user terminal may display an application interface of the NFC management application, and group the plurality of NFC emulated cards by receiving a user input at the application interface, and set a corresponding group identifier.
In some embodiments of the present application, in order to improve accuracy of screening correct NFC analog cards from multiple NFC analog cards, fig. 4 is a flowchart of still another embodiment of a near field communication interaction method provided in the first aspect of the present application, and step 230 of selecting, by an NFC management application, a target NFC analog card matching a target scene identifier from multiple NFC analog cards may include steps 410 to 430 shown in fig. 4.
Step 410, through the NFC management application, selecting a target scene packet with a packet identifier consistent with the target scene identifier from the plurality of scene packets;
step 420, determining, by the NFC management application, that the unique NFC emulated card is the target NFC emulated card if the unique NFC emulated card exists in the target scenario packet;
in step 430, in the case that the number of NFC emulated cards in the target scenario packet is greater than 1, the NFC emulated card with the highest priority in the target scenario packet is determined to be the target NFC emulated card by the NFC management application.
In the embodiment of the application, the target scene group matched with the scene where the card swiping terminal is located can be screened by comparing the group identifier with the target scene identifier, and when only one NFC analog card exists in the target scene group, the NFC management application can directly take the NFC analog card as the target NFC analog card; when the target scene group contains two or more NFC simulation cards, the accuracy of screening correct NFC simulation cards from the NFC simulation cards can be improved by setting the NFC simulation card with the highest priority as the target NFC simulation card.
In some embodiments of the application, the priority may be determined based on one or more of user settings, geographic location, user behavior habit data.
The user may set the priority of the NFC emulated card by himself, for example, set the priority order of the plurality of NFC emulated cards, or set a certain NFC emulated card as a default NFC emulated card, so that the priority of the default NFC emulated card is higher than that of other NFC emulated cards that are not set as defaults. Each NFC emulated card may be associated with a piece of geographic location information, the closer the geographic location information is to the address location information of the swipe terminal, the higher the similarity of the NFC emulated card. The user behavior habit data may include user card swiping behavior data, where the user card swiping behavior data includes information such as card type, card swiping success or failure, card swiping time of the user using the NFC analog card, and the information may be obtained by an application program on the user terminal or a call log.
In the related art, when detecting an NFC radio frequency signal, a user terminal invokes an NFC management application, and in a scenario in which the user terminal is provided with a default NFC analog card, the NFC management application directly reads the default NFC analog card, and performs NFC communication interaction with a card swiping terminal by using the default NFC analog card as a current NFC communication object. In this way, when the default NFC analog card is not matched with the scene where the current card swiping terminal is located, for example, the default NFC analog card is an access control card, and the card swiping terminal is a gate of a subway station, the card swiping failure will occur.
In some embodiments of the present application, the plurality of NFC emulated cards include a default NFC emulated card, and in order to avoid a card swiping failure in the related art, fig. 5 is a flowchart of still another embodiment of a near field communication interaction method provided in the first aspect of the present application, and step 230 may include steps 510 to 540 shown in fig. 5.
Step 510, receiving, by the NFC controller, NFC application interaction data sent by the card swiping terminal and invoking an NFC management application, in the case of detecting an NFC radio frequency signal;
step 520, forwarding, by the NFC controller, the NFC application interaction data to the NFC management application, so that the NFC management application obtains a packet identifier of the default NFC emulated card and compares the packet identifier of the default NFC emulated card with the target scene identifier when receiving the NFC application interaction data;
step 530, determining, by the NFC management application, that the target NFC emulated card is a default NFC emulated card, and directly forwarding NFC application interaction data to a card application of the default NFC emulated card, if the packet identifier matches the target scene identifier;
step 540, in the case that the packet identifier does not match with the target scene identifier, the NFC management application is configured to screen the target scene packet with the packet identifier consistent with the target scene identifier from the plurality of scene packets, and directly forward the NFC application interaction data to the card application of the target NFC analog card in the target scene packet.
Specifically, the NFC controller may be an NFC control chip. The NFC application interaction data are used for the user terminal to conduct near field communication interaction through the NFC analog card and the card swiping terminal according to application specifications, wherein the application specifications are specifications of card applications of the NFC analog card.
For example, in a scenario where the NFC emulated card is a financial IC card, the application specification may be a PBOC specification, where the PBOC specification includes standard interaction instructions such as PPSE.
In the embodiment of the application, when receiving the NFC application interaction data sent by the card swiping terminal, the NFC controller does not directly send the NFC application interaction data to the card application of the default NFC analog card, but sends the NFC application interaction data to the NFC management application, and the NFC management application forwards the data. Based on the method, the NFC management application can acquire the grouping identification of the default NFC analog card and compare the grouping identification with the target scene identification before forwarding the data, so that the NFC application interaction data can be directly forwarded to the card application of the default NFC analog card under the condition that the grouping identification is matched with the target scene identification; or under the condition that the grouping identification is not matched with the target scene identification, the NFC management application screens the target scene grouping with the grouping identification consistent with the target scene identification from the plurality of scene groupings, and directly forwards NFC application interaction data to the card application of the target NFC analog card in the target scene grouping. Therefore, when NFC communication interaction between the default NFC analog card and the card swiping terminal is carried out, the NFC management application can avoid the situation that card swiping fails due to mismatching of scenes where the default NFC analog card and the card swiping terminal are located, and the reliability of NFC card swiping is improved.

In step 710, the card swiping terminal may broadcast the scene message through a preset broadcasting method, which may include: at least one of bluetooth, wireless communication technology, wireless carrier communication technology, radio frequency identification technology.
In some embodiments of the present application, step 710 may include: the target scene identification is added in the payload of the scene message.
In other embodiments, the swipe terminal may set the non-connectible attribute and the broadcast interval in the header of the presence message.
In some embodiments of the present application, step 710 may specifically include: the swipe terminal continuously broadcasts the scene message.
For example, the card swiping terminal can be an access control device in an access control scene, and the access control device can continuously broadcast a scene message that the current scene is an "access control scene".
In other embodiments of the present application, the swipe terminal non-continuously broadcasts a scene message, and step 720 may specifically include: and broadcasting the scene message in a preset broadcasting mode under the condition of starting the card reading operation.
For example, the card swiping terminal can be a POS terminal in a transaction scene, and the POS terminal can start broadcasting scene information after receiving a card reading operation of a user, so that resource waste caused by continuous broadcasting is avoided.
